Warning Signs You Need Office Building Water Damage Restoration

Water damage can be sneaky, but there are often warning signs that show a problem.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age.

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show moisture in the walls or floors. Don't ignore these signs, they can lead to mold growth and further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le. If you notice this, it's ess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ains can show a leak or moisture issue. Don't delay, address the problem before it escalates.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can show moisture in the walls. Don't ignore these signs, they can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Water-Damaged Furniture or Fixtures

Water damage can affect furniture, lighting fixtures, and other equipment. If you notice water damage, it's ess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Discoloration or Fading of Carpets or Upholstery

Water damage can cause discoloration or fading of carpets and upholstery. Don't ignore these signs, they can show a more significant problem.

Office Building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ak in a single room Yes No You can likely handle a small leak on your own with some basic equipment and DIY skills.
Widespread water damage from a flood or burst pipe No Yes Professional help is necessary to prevent further damage and ensure your property is safe and secure.
Water damage to electrical systems or appliances No Yes Electrical systems and appliances need specialized knowledge and equipment to repair safely and effectively.
Water damage to sensitive equipment or documents No Yes Professional help is necessary to prevent damage to sensitive equipment and documents.
Water damage to a large commercial space No Yes Professional help is necessary to ensure your property is safe and secure, and to prevent further damage.

Office Building Water Damage Restoration Cost in Florence, KY

The cost of office building water dam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Florence, KY. Our estimates are based on the extent of the damage and the equipment and materials needed to restore your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response $500 - $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, equipment and materials needed
Water Extraction $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, equipment and materials needed
Drying and Dehumidification $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, equipment and materials needed
Sanitizing and Cleaning $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, equipment and materials needed
Final Inspection and Restoration $1,000 - $5,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, equipment and materials needed

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work with you to develop a customized plan to restore your property and prevent future water damage.
